Silver coin

A coin made from silver. It is believed that the first silver coins with a fixed shape, fineness, and weight were minted in Greece around the 7th century BC. In Japan, the Wado silver coin is the oldest, but the oldest silver coin in full circulation is the Keicho silver coin. Silver coins have been considered standard currency alongside gold coins since ancient times, but because silver was produced in greater areas and in greater quantities, silver coins were actually used more often, and were particularly widely used in Mediterranean trade in the 13th and 14th centuries. However, as the gold standard came into widespread use in the second half of the 19th century, silver coins generally came to be used as secondary currency.
